DEFINITION A neutral third party appointed by the disputants to obtain a proposed final settlement offer from each party. Without disclosing the content, the Confidential Listener advises the parties if their offers are within a specified range. The range usually is agreed upon by the parties in advance, along with a mechanism for dividing the difference in the event that the offers overlap. If the offers are outside the specified range, the Confidential Listener may assist the parties in bridging the gap and achieving a final settlement
NEUTRAL Impartial third person selected by parties to listen to offers and facilitate settlement negotiations
ROLE OF LAWYERS Can provide offer to listener and engage in settlement negotiations
ROLE OF PARTIES Can provide offer to listener and engage in settlement negotiations
SCOPE OF PROCESS Pursuant to agreement of parties; sometimes occurs during mediation as a means of closure; somewhat structured to ensure confidentiality
OUTCOME Negotiated settlement; Win - Win
